witwu

Beginner 📱 Gen-Z / Internet Slang

Definition

who is there with you

Breadcrumbing

Breadcrumbing is when a person leads someone on in a romantic way with no intention of committing to a relationship (ship). The "breadcrumber" may do it on accident, but typically they do it on purpose because they enjoy being pursued and fawned over.
